+/*
+ * This is a native test to explore how the readdir() family works.
+ * Newlib supports the following readdir() family members:
+ *
+ * closedir() -
+ * readdir() -
+ * scandir() -
+ * opendir() -
+ * rewinddir() -
+ * telldir() - BSD not in POSIX
+ * seekdir() - BSD not in POSIX
+ *
+ *
+ * seekdir() takes an offset which is a byte offset. The Linux
+ * implementation of this appears to seek to the ((off/DIRENT_SIZE) + 1)
+ * record where DIRENT_SIZE seems to be 12 bytes.
+ *
+ *
+ *
+ * $Id$
+ */
